What "Energy-Efficient" Actually Means Here
Energy performance ratings on a window label — U-factor and Solar Heat Gain Coefficient (SHGC) — matter, but they only tell part of the story in a marine climate. A window with excellent U-factor numbers is still a bad investment if the frame corrodes, the seals fail early from constant moisture exposure, or the installation doesn't account for wind-driven rain.
U-Factor and SHGC in Plain Terms
U-factor measures how much heat escapes through the window — lower is better for our cooler, wet winters. SHGC measures how much solar heat comes through the glass — for Bow's mild, often overcast summers, this matters less than it would in a sunnier inland climate, so we weigh U-factor more heavily when helping a homeowner pick glazing.
Glazing Options
Most homes here do well with a quality double-pane, low-E, argon-filled unit. Triple-pane glass offers a further step up in insulation and sound dampening, which some homeowners value given nearby road or water traffic, but it adds weight, cost, and isn't always necessary to hit a comfortable, efficient result in this climate. We'll walk through the honest trade-off rather than upsell glass a house doesn't need.
Frame Material: The Decision That Matters Most Near Saltwater
In a coastal-influenced climate like Bow's, frame material affects long-term performance more than almost any other choice. Salt air accelerates corrosion on unprotected metal hardware and finishes, and constant moisture punishes any material prone to swelling, rot, or peeling paint.
| Frame Material | Salt Air / Moisture Behavior | Maintenance | General Cost Tier |
|---|---|---|---|
| Vinyl | Won't rot or corrode; UV can affect finish over many years | Low — occasional cleaning | Lower |
| Fiberglass | Very stable in moisture and temperature swings; strong resistance to salt exposure | Low | Mid to higher |
| Wood-clad | Attractive, but exposed wood or damaged cladding is vulnerable near saltwater | Higher — needs monitoring at joints and sills | Higher |
| Aluminum | Prone to corrosion and heat transfer without thermal breaks; generally not our recommendation this close to the water | Moderate | Lower to mid |

Signs Your Current Windows Are Losing the Battle
Window failure in this climate is gradual. Here's what we tell homeowners to watch for between now and their next full exterior check:
- Fogging or a hazy look between panes — a sign the seal has failed and insulating gas has escaped
- Persistent moss or dark algae staining on the sill or bottom frame, even after cleaning
- Drafts you can feel near the frame on a windy day, especially during a driving rainstorm
- Sashes that stick, stay stuck, or won't latch fully — often a sign of swelling or warping
- Soft, spongy, or discolored wood at the corners or bottom of a wood-frame window
- Visible daylight or a gap where the frame meets the siding or trim
- Condensation forming on the inside of the glass regularly, beyond normal winter humidity
Any one of these on its own might not mean a full replacement. Several together, especially on the weather-facing side of a house, usually mean the window system has reached the end of its useful life.
What a Correct Installation Actually Involves
Energy-efficient glass only performs as well as the installation around it. This is where a lot of window jobs quietly go wrong, and it's the part homeowners can't easily inspect once trim is back in place.
Flashing and Water Management
Every opening needs proper flashing that directs water down and out, never trapping it behind the frame. In a climate with sustained driving rain, a flashing detail that's "close enough" eventually lets water into the wall assembly — and that damage often isn't visible until it's significant.
Sealant and Sill Prep
Sill pans, backer rod, and the right sealant at the right joints matter more here than in a drier climate. We treat sealant as a backup to good flashing, not a substitute for it.
Fit and Insulation
A window that's shimmed correctly and insulated around the frame — without over-packing insulation that can bow the frame — performs as designed. A window that's slightly out of square loses efficiency and stresses the seals faster, regardless of how good the glass unit itself is.
Respecting the Existing Wall Assembly
Older homes in this area may not have a modern rain screen or drainage plane behind the siding. We evaluate what's actually there before assuming a one-size-fits-all install method, so the new window works with the house instead of against it.

What Affects the Cost of a Window Project
Every home is different, but these are the main factors that move a project's price up or down. We'll give you specifics for your home during an on-site estimate rather than a number that doesn't account for your actual house.
| Factor | Why It Matters |
|---|---|
| Number and size of openings | More or larger windows means more material and labor |
| Frame material chosen | Vinyl, fiberglass, and wood-clad carry different material costs |
| Glazing (double vs. triple-pane) | Triple-pane adds cost and weight for a further efficiency gain |
| Condition behind the existing window | Hidden rot or moisture damage found during removal adds repair scope |
| Access and height | Second-story or hard-to-reach windows take more time and equipment |
| Trim and finish work | Matching existing trim profiles or repainting adds to the scope |
